Power Consumption and Vehicle Compatibility
This is the big one. Check your car or truck’s fuse rating for the 12v outlet (cigarette lighter). Most outlets support 10-15 amps, but a cooktop can draw a lot. You’ll need to know it’s wattage—a 150-watt model draws about 12.5 amps, while a 200-watt pulls nearly 17. Exceeding your fuse limit will just trip it. Always verify your vehicle’s capacity first to avoid a suprise power cut.
Pot and Pan Compatibility
Induction only works with magnetic cookware. A simple test: if a magnet sticks firmly to the bottom of your pot, it’ll work. If not, you’re out of luck. Many portable sets use aluminum, which won’t function. Stainless steel or cast iron are you’re best bets. Some units come with a compatible pot, which solves the problem right away.
Temperature Control and Safety
Look for models with multiple heat settings or adjustable temperature. A simple on/off switch offers less control, which can lead to boiling over or uneven heating. Built-in safety features are crucial—auto-shutoff timers and overheat protection prevent accidents in a moving vehicle or a small space. A stable, non-slip base is another good feature for safety on uneven surfaces.

Frequently Asked Questions About 12v Induction Cooktop
What is a 12v induction cooktop?
It’s a portable cooking device that runs on a 12-volt DC power source. You can plug it into your car, truck, RV, or boat’s accessory socket. It uses magnetic induction to heat your cookware directly.
Will it work in my car?
Probably, but you need to check your vehicle’s power outlet. Most standard car outlets (cigarette lighter sockets) are rated for 10 amps. A 12v cooktop often needs more power than that. It’s best to use a direct connection to teh battery or a heavy-duty outlet in an RV.
What kind of pots and pans can I use?
You need cookware with a magnetic base. Cast iron and many stainless steel pots work great. A simple test is to see if a magnet sticks firmly to the bottom of your pan. If it does, your good to go.
Is it safe to use indoors or in a vehicle?
Yes, thay are generally very safe. The surface itself doesn’t get as hot as a traditional burner. It only heats the pot. Most models have automatic shut-off features for extra safety. Always ensure good ventilation when cooking.
How fast does it boil water?
It’s slower than a kitchen plug-in induction hob or a gas stove. Boiling a small amount of water for coffee might take a few minutes. It’s perfect for simple meals, reheating soup, or making a quick pasta dish while on the road.
Can I use it for all my cooking?
It’s best for light to medium cooking tasks. Think boiling, simmering, and light frying. It’s not ideal for high-heat searing or very large meals. It’s a fantastic companion for travel, camping, or small spaces where a full kitchen isn’t available.
